Jim Blandy <jimb@redhat.com> writes: > That's odd; I have logs of a clean build from early this morning, > after my commit. CVS didn't say I had any locally modified files. > What didn't compile? I've rebuilt with GCC 4 instead of GCC 3, and now I get warnings, which are being treated as errors: gcc -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I/home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es -I. -D_GNU_SOURCE -I. -I/home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es -I../bfd -I/home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/../include -I/home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/../bfd -I/home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/../intl -I../intl -W -Wall -Wstrict-prototypes -Wmissing-prototypes -Werror -g3 -c /home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/m32c-asm.c -o m32c-asm.o cc1: warnings being treated as errors /home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/m32c-asm.c: In function 'parse_imm1_S': /home/jimb/binutils/src/opcodes/m32c-asm.c:350: warning: pointer targets in passing argument 4 of 'cgen_parse_unsigned_integer' differ in signedness I'll take care of these. If this isn't the problem you ran into, please let me know.
